It usually takes around 10 hours 5 minutes to travel the 269 miles (432 km) from Peterborough to Redruth by train, although you can get there in as little as 6 hours 52 minutes on the fastest services. You'll normally find around 4 trains per day running on this route. You'll need to make 1 change along the way as there aren't any direct services on this line. You're likely to be travelling with Great Western Railway, Thameslink or CrossCountry to Redruth.
